We Work Remotely
We Work Remotely (WWR) is an online job board dedicated exclusively to remote work opportunities. Since its launch in 2013, it has become one of the largest platforms of its kind, drawing around six million visitors each month and fostering a sizable global community centered around remote work. For employers, WWR provides a straightforward way to connect with remote talent. Posting a job costs $299, and the platform claims that over 90% of listings are successfully filled. Companies can expect a high volume of applications, with filtering tools available to streamline the hiring process. WWR also offers bundle packages for businesses looking to post multiple listings, and jobs posted on the platform are distributed to a network of partner sites, including Google Jobs and several niche job boards. Cruises.com is a website that offers a variety of cruise deals, including exclusive offers and perks. It features easy-to-use search tools and provides extensive information about different cruise lines and destinations.
Some cons of using cruises.com include the fact that it does not include taxes and other fees in the advertised prices, which has been described as deceptive. For example, an Alaskan cruise advertised as $500 per person ended up costing $858 per person once all fees were included. No specific pros have been listed by users at this time.
